Denmark’s Tax Authorities to Gather Data about Crypto Traders, Clamps Down on Digital Asset Traders
The Danish Tax Agency, Skattestyrelsen, announced on January 14 via their website, that it will be gathering trader data from 3 digital currency exchanges including localbitcoins to guarantee that clients are fully paying the right taxes. Data about foreign citizens, companies and organizations will be shared with other nations.

Denmark-Based Bank That Prohibited Bitcoin, is Now Indicted of Money Laundering
Nordea Bank is among the largest and most famous financial institutions in the Nordic nations. The Nordic nations include Finland, Iceland, Denmark, Sweden and Norway. The financial team made news in January 2018. The bank put a ban on flagship digital currencies such as BTC, ETH and Litecoin.

Denmark's Biggest Bank is Combing Through $150 bn Involved in Money Laundering
Firms from Russia and several parts of the former Soviet Union have allegedly turned the tiny nation of Estonia into a money laundering haven. An ongoing investigation into the Estonian branch of Danske Bank is combing through a large $150 Bn that may have been largely involved.
